Designed by
Title
View of the city of St. Petersburg and the Neva River, a regatta #125599452
Description
View of the nigga saint petersburg and the river Neva, regatta on sailing boats on the river Neva, the building of the exchange, the dome of St. Isaac`s Cathedral in St. Petersburg, the sights of St. Petersburg, Russia